Job summary

Waipā District Council is seeking a proactive Development Engineer to provide engineering advice across subdivision and land use projects, ensuring development meets requirements and is delivered safely and to a high standard.

This role collaborates with developers, consultants and internal teams, performing development consent assessments, design reviews, site inspections and roading and infrastructure guidance.

Rich in heritage and proudly known as the Home of Champions, Waipā is experiencing significant growth across our towns and communities. At Waipā District Council, you'll have the opportunity to work alongside developers, consultants, contractors, internal teams and our communities to help shape how the district develops.

Our Development Engineering team is collaborative, technically focused and committed to finding practical solutions that enable growth while protecting the long-term interests of the district.

As a Development Engineer, you'll provide engineering advice and support across subdivision and land use projects, helping ensure development meets Council requirements and is delivered safely, sustainably and to a high standard.

It's a varied role covering development consent assessments, engineering design reviews, site inspections, vehicle crossings and certification. You'll work closely with developers, consultants, contractors and internal teams to provide practical advice, resolve issues and deliver good development outcomes.

Key responsibilities include:

  • Assessing subdivision and land use applications and providing development engineering recommendations.
  • Reviewing engineering designs and supporting s223 and s224 certification processes.
  • Leading vehicle crossing applications and providing advice to developers, contractors and the public.
  • Monitoring and auditing subdivision and land use works through site inspections.
  • Providing advice on roading, three water services, infrastructure and engineering requirements.
  • Contributing to improvements in Council standards, processes, procedures and bylaws.
  • Working collaboratively with internal and external stakeholders to resolve issues and achieve practical outcomes.
